Google llc (20240184620). INVOKING FUNCTIONS OF AGENTS VIA DIGITAL ASSISTANT APPLICATIONS USING ADDRESS TEMPLATES simplified abstract

From WikiPatents
Jump to navigation Jump to search

INVOKING FUNCTIONS OF AGENTS VIA DIGITAL ASSISTANT APPLICATIONS USING ADDRESS TEMPLATES

Organization Name

google llc

Inventor(s)

Jason Douglas of Mountain View CA (US)

Carey Radebaugh of Mountain View CA (US)

Ilya Firman of Sunnyvale CA (US)

Ulas Kirazci of Mountain View CA (US)

Luv Kothari of Sunnyvale CA (US)

INVOKING FUNCTIONS OF AGENTS VIA DIGITAL ASSISTANT APPLICATIONS USING ADDRESS TEMPLATES - A simplified explanation of the abstract

This abstract first appeared for US patent application 20240184620 titled 'INVOKING FUNCTIONS OF AGENTS VIA DIGITAL ASSISTANT APPLICATIONS USING ADDRESS TEMPLATES

Simplified Explanation

The patent application describes systems and methods for invoking functions of agents via digital assistant applications. Here is a simplified explanation of the abstract:

  • Each action-inventory has an address template for an action by an agent.
  • The address template includes a portion with an input variable for executing the action.
  • A data processing system parses an input audio signal to identify a request and parameter to be executed by the agent.
  • The system selects an action-inventory for the corresponding request and generates an address using the template.
  • An action data structure including the address is directed to the agent to execute the action and provide output.

Potential applications of this technology include voice-activated digital assistants, smart home automation systems, and customer service chatbots.

Problems solved by this technology include streamlining communication with agents, improving user experience, and enabling efficient execution of tasks.

Benefits of this technology include increased automation, enhanced user interaction, and improved productivity.

Potential commercial applications of this technology could be in the fields of customer service, virtual assistants, and IoT devices.

Possible prior art may include existing voice recognition systems, task automation software, and natural language processing technologies.

      1. Unanswered Questions
        1. How does this technology handle multiple requests simultaneously?

This technology can handle multiple requests simultaneously by prioritizing and queuing the requests based on factors such as urgency, user preferences, and system capabilities.

        1. What security measures are in place to protect user data during interactions with agents?

Security measures such as encryption, authentication protocols, and data anonymization techniques can be implemented to protect user data during interactions with agents.

      1. Frequently Updated Research

Research on improving natural language processing algorithms for more accurate voice recognition and response generation is frequently updated in the field of artificial intelligence and human-computer interaction.


Original Abstract Submitted

systems and methods of invoking functions of agents via digital assistant applications are provided. each action-inventory can have an address template for an action by an agent. the address template can include a portion having an input variable used to execute the action. a data processing system can parse an input audio signal from a client device to identify a request and a parameter to be executed by the agent. the data processing system can select an action-inventory for the action corresponding to the request. the data processing system can generate, using the address template, an address. the address can include a substring having the parameter used to control execution of the action. the data processing system can direct an action data structure including the address to the agent to cause the agent to execute the action and to provide output for presentation.